17. Mr. Kamau, a salesman is paid a commission of 6% on goods worth over sh. 600,000. In addition
he is paid a monthly salary of sh. 35,000.
(a) Calculate his total earnings in a month when his total sales was sh. 750,000. (3mks)

(b) In the following month, the rate of commission was changed to x% but his monthly salary
remained the same. If Mr. Kamau received a total monthly earning of sh. 100,000 for
selling goods worth the same amount, find the value of x. (3mks)

(c) If the rate of commission in (b) above was reduced in the ration 3:4 and his monthly
increased by 10%, find the percentage change in his total monthly earnings for selling the
same amount of goods. (4mks)

21. A lamp shade is in the form of an open – ended frustum of a cone. Its bottom and top diameters
are 14cm and 7cm respectively. Its height is 10cm.

(a) Find

(i) the height of the cone from which the frustum was cut. (2mks)

(ii) the area of the curved surface of the lamp shade. (5mks)

Use   3.142

(b) The material used for making the lamp shade is sold at sh. 800 per square metre. Find the
cost of ten lampshades if a lampshade is sold at twice the cost of the material. (3mks)

22. The distance between tours X and Y is 320km. A car and a lorry started from X at the same time
and travelled towards Y. The car travelling at an average speed of 20km/h higher than that of the
lorry reached r 48 minutes earlier than the lorry.

(a) If the speed of the lorry is t km / h , find the value of t. (6mks)

(b) If the two vehicles left town X at 8. 15 a.m, determine the time the ca arrived at town Y.
(4mks)

23. Two aeroplanes P and Q leave airport at the same time, P flies on a bearing of 0750 at 800 km/h.
While Q flies on a bearing of 1500 at 1000 km\h.

(a) Using a scale of 1 cm to represent 100km, draw a diagram to show the positions of the
aeroplanes after 45 minutes. (4mks)

(b) Use your scale drawing to determine

(i) the distance between the two aeroplanes after 45 minutes. (2mks)

(ii) The bearing of P from Q. (1mk)

(c) By further construction on the same diagram determine how far Q is to east of P. (3mks)
